Abstract:
A process for producing an eye at one or both ends of a coverbraided rope, the process comprising the steps of: a) providing a spacer; b) situating the spacer proximal a splice braid zone of an eye of the sling formed of the core rope; c) forming with a braiding machine a braided sheath about the splice braid zone to about the location where the splice braid zone meets its eye and covering at least portions of the spacer with at least a portion of the braided sheath; d) withdrawing from converging braid strands the eye having had its splice braid already covered by the braided sheath; e) forming with the braiding machine a length of hollow braided sheath; f) severing the length of hollow braided sheath; g) attaching to the spacer a severed end of the hollow braided sheath formed of the same strands that form at least a portion of the braided sheath and subsequently pulling the spacer out from between the braided sheath and the core rope in a direction that draws the severed end of the braided sheath into the braided sheath and causes it to occupy a position that previously was occupied by the spacer.
Abstract:
A jacket for a load-bearing, lengthy body, wherein the jacket is comprised of a plurality of braid elements which, when braided, enclose at least a portion of the lengthy body, and wherein the braid element is comprised of a braided ribbon. A method of forming the jacket is also described.
Abstract:
The invention relates to a continuous method for producing a fiber-reinforced composite material consisting of multiple fibers embedded in a polymer matrix, in particular for producing a tension member, said method having the following steps: -providing at least two rovings, -spreading the at least two rovings, -joining the at least two spread rovings such that the at least two joined rovings form fiber layers that are arranged one above the other and/or one next to the other at least in some regions, -impregnating the at least two joined rovings with a polymer and/or a polymer precursor, and -pultruding the at least two impregnated rovings.
Abstract:
A process of producing an eye in a rope (35), the process including the following steps: providing a strength member core (37) of the rope and further comprising the steps of: (a) situating a removable elongate object adjacent to at least a portion of the strength member core (37) of the rope; (b) subsequently covering the strength member core (37) of the rope and the removable elongate object with at least a portion of a braided sheath (398) formed of strands (397); (c) attaching to the removable elongate object a portion of a structure formed of the same strands (397) that form the at least a portion of the braided sheath (398); and (d) subsequently removing the removable elongate object from the braided sheath (398) so as to cause the portion of the structure attached to the removable elongate object to be drawn into at least a portion of the space within the braided sheath (398) enclosing the at least a portion of the strength member core (37) of the rope that was originally occupied by the removable elongate object, whereby a rope portion with an eye which a mainly coverbraided is economically produced. Also disclosed is a rope portion obtained with said process and a trawl including such a rope portion. Furthermore a trawl comprising a coverbraided rope sling / grommet, where the respective eye is free of any strand forming the braided jacket of the rope portion is disclosed.
Abstract:
In the method according to the invention in the manufacture of an elevator the following procedures are performed, -a movable supporting platform (4) and an elevator car (2), and possibly a counterweight (CW), are installed in the elevator hoistway (1), -the rope installation is performed, in which the elevator is reeved to comprise construction-time hoisting roping (3,3'), and the hoisting roping (3,3') is arranged to support the elevator car (2) resting on the supporting platform (4) supported in its position above the elevator car (2), -the elevator car (2) is taken into use to serve passengers and/or to transport goods, -the elevator car (2) is removed from the aforementioned use, - the service range of the elevator car is changed to reach higher up in the elevator hoistway (1) by lifting the supporting platform higher up in the elevator hoistway with hoisting means (22,30), -the elevator car (2) is taken back into the aforementioned use. In the aforementioned rope installation the elevator is reeved to comprise construction-time hoisting roping (3,3')/ which comprises one or more ropes, the longitudinal power transmission capacity of which is based at least essentially on non-metallic fibers in the longitudinal direction of the rope. In the method guide rails (G) to be fixed with guide rail brackets (b) can additionally be installed by the aid of installation means (8,9). The invention also relates to an elevator arrangement, with which the aforementioned method can be performed.
Abstract:
An object of the present invention is to make it possible to provide a cord, in particular, a cord for reinforcing a rubber article in which rubber permeation properties are improved by coating filaments as constituents of the cord with rubber in a reliable and stable manner. The cord of the present invention is produced by, when the metal filament is guided to an extruder and extruded together with rubber from a mouthpiece of the extruder so that the metal filament is coated with the rubber, juxtaposing plural metal filaments in the mouthpiece and extruding the metal filaments together with rubber.
Abstract:
A steel cord (1) comprising a core (3) formed by bundling three or more filaments (2) side by side without twisting and a sheath (5) of at least one layer comprised of plural filaments (4) wound around the core, characterized in that an arrangement of the filaments (2) constituting the core (3) at a section perpendicular to a longitudinal direction of the core differs between at least a part in the longitudinal direction of the core and the other part thereof, and all filaments (2) constituting the core (3) in all section parts are arranged in a rectangle having a long side of d x (n+1) and a short side of d x (1+1/2 1/2 ) when the diameter of the filament is d and the number of the filaments in the core is n. Such steel cords are used in a belt of a pneumatic tire. Also, these cords are produced by a tubular-type twisting machine having a specified structure.
